In Bondi Vet season 2 episode 2, titled Lucky Catfight, we see the return of Dr. Chris Brown as he faces his toughest cases yet. The episode opens with a cat owner who has noticed a strange growth on her pet's neck. After being examined by Dr. Chris, the cat is diagnosed with cancer and requires immediate surgery. The owner is understandably upset, but Dr. Chris assures her that he will do everything in his power to save her beloved feline friend.
Next, Dr. Chris is introduced to a couple who have recently adopted a dog from a local shelter. However, the dog is exhibiting strange behavior and may have an underlying medical condition. After performing a comprehensive exam, Dr. Chris determines that the dog has a neurological disorder and will need further testing and treatment.
In the following segment, we meet a family who are worried about their pet horse who has been behaving strangely. Dr. Chris visits the horse and discovers that it has a back injury that requires medication and rest. The family is relieved to hear that their beloved horse will recover and be back to its normal self in no time.
The episode then takes a more dramatic turn as we meet a dog owner who is worried about his pet's aggressive behavior towards other dogs. Dr. Chris examines the dog and determines that it may be suffering from anxiety. He recommends behavioral training and medication to help calm the dog's nerves.
Finally, we see Dr. Chris visit a wildlife sanctuary to assist with the rehabilitation of a kangaroo who has been injured by a car. The kangaroo requires surgery for a broken leg, which Dr. Chris performs successfully. The kangaroo is then taken to a rehabilitation facility to recover and, hopefully, be released back into the wild.
